The Power Of Book Reviews In Self-Publishing

Self-publishing has become a popular option for many aspiring authors in recent years. Without the need to go through traditional publishing routes, self-publishing allows writers to bring their work directly to readers. However, with so many books being self-published every day, it can be challenging for authors to stand out in a crowded field. This is where book reviews come in.

The Importance of Book Reviews

Book reviews play a crucial role in helping self-published authors gain exposure and credibility. Positive reviews can help build trust with readers and increase sales. On the other hand, negative reviews can deter potential readers and hurt an author’s reputation.

When a reader is browsing for books online, they are often overwhelmed by the sheer number of options available. This is where book reviews can help. Reviews provide readers with valuable insights into the quality of a book and help them make informed decisions about their purchases.

The Impact of Book Reviews

Positive reviews can have a powerful impact on an author’s success. They can boost a book’s visibility and help it climb the rankings on online retail platforms. In addition, positive reviews can generate buzz around a book and attract the attention of literary agents and traditional publishers.

Conversely, negative reviews can have a detrimental effect on an author’s career. They can damage an author’s reputation and make it harder for them to sell future books. Authors must pay attention to reviews and take feedback into consideration when improving their craft.

The Role of Book Reviewers

Book reviewers play a vital role in the self-publishing industry. They help connect readers with new books and provide valuable feedback to authors. In addition, book reviewers can help authors generate buzz around their work and reach a wider audience.

Authors should cultivate relationships with book reviewers and engage with them to build a loyal following. By working with book reviewers, authors can gain valuable insights into their writing and improve their craft.
